SIMM: The Predecessor
SIMM modules represent an earlier generation of computer memory, prevalent from the 1980s to the mid-1990s. For synchronous dynamic RAM (SDRAM) chips, SIMMs had to be installed in pairs to achieve the necessary 64-bit data width required by the computer. This pairing requirement was a direct consequence of the narrower data bus of individual SIMM modules.
DIMM: The Evolution
DIMM, which stands for Dual In-line Memory Module, emerged as a significant improvement over SIMM. The primary distinction lies in its design: DIMM modules feature separate electrical contacts on both sides of the PCB, doubling the number of pins available for connection. This "dual-in-line" configuration allows DIMMs to utilize a wider 64-bit data bus, dramatically increasing data transfer rates compared to SIMMs.

This incompatibility means that upgrading from a SIMM-based system to a DIMM-based one typically requires replacing the motherboard. DIMMs operate at lower voltages, commonly 3.3 volts, contributing to reduced power consumption and heat generation.
One of the key advancements with DIMM is their capacity for higher storage. While SIMMs topped out around 64 MB, DIMMs can support capacities up to 1 GB and significantly more with newer generations. Different types of DIMMs exist, catering to various needs, including UDIMM (Unbuffered DIMM), RDIMM (Registered DIMM), and SODIMM (Small Outline DIMM). Key Differences and Compatibility
The fundamental differences between SIMM and DIMM can be summarized as follows:
* Contacts: SIMM has one set of connected contacts; DIMM has separate contacts on both sidesDifference between DIMM and SIMM in memory slots?.
* Data Bus: SIMM typically uses a 32-bit data bus; DIMM uses a 64-bit data bus.

* Compatibility: SIMM and DIMM slots are not interchangeable. A DIMM cannot fit into a SIMM slot, and vice-versa.
